What are the risks associated with crypto mortgage lending?

One major risk is the volatility of cryptocurrencies. The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ate dramatically, which means that if the value of the cryptocurrency used as collateral drops significantly, the lender may not be able to recover the full value of the loan. Additionally, there is the risk of fraud and hacking. Since cryptocurrencies are digital assets, they can be vulnerable to cyber attacks and theft. It's important for lenders to have robust security measures in place to protect against these risks. Finally, there is the risk of regulatory uncertainty. The regulatory environment for cryptocurrencies is still evolving, and there may be changes in regulations that could impact the viability of crypto mortgage lending. Lenders need to stay informed and adapt to any regulatory changes that may occur.
- Student WangJan 04, 2021 · 5 years agoCrypto mortgage lending can be a risky endeavor. One of the main risks is the potential for default. If the borrower is unable to repay the loan, the lender may not be able to recover the full value of the loan due to the volatility of cryptocurrencies. Another risk is the lack of transparency. Unlike traditional mortgage lending, crypto mortgage lending may not have the same level of oversight and regulation, which can increase the risk of fraud and scams. Additionally, there is the risk of market manipulation. Since the cryptocurrency market is relatively unregulated, there is the potential for individuals or groups to manipulate the market to their advantage, which can negatively impact the value of the collateral. It's important for lenders to carefully assess these risks and implement appropriate risk management strategies.
